Guided walking tour of Weimar's significant landmarks

Embark on a fascinating exploration of Weimar by foot. As you traverse the city's most significant landmarks during the public tour, you'll gain insight into its history and perhaps even find amusement in a few intriguing anecdotes. The journey begins at the bustling market square, leading you across the symbolic Square of Democracy. From there, you'll stroll past the serene park, making your way to the renowned Bauhaus University.Continuing your adventure, you'll visit the historic cemetery before arriving at Goethe's residence, a testament to the city's literary heritage. Your path then takes you down Schillerstrasse, culminating at the theatre square. Here, you'll encounter the celebrated monument dedicated to the famed poet couple, a fitting end to your enlightening tour of Weimar. Accessibility: * Unfortunately, this experience is not suitable for guests with reduced mobility Know in advance: * This tour is only offered in German * Your guide will lead you on the following route: Market square with town hall, Lucas Cranach House, court pharmacy and Hotel Elephant, Square of Democracy with a view of the city palace, princely house and Duchess Anna Amalia Library, ginkgo tree, park on the Ilm river with Goethe's garden house, Liszthaus, Van de Velde building of the Bauhaus University, historic cemetery, Goethe's residence, Schiller's residence, German National Theatre on theatre square with the Goethe-Schiller monument
